General Education Requirements


Contact your program advisor to select general education courses from each category which will meet your program’s graduation requirements. See General Education Courses (GELOs)    for a complete list.

One class from each GELO listed below.  See General Education for eligible classes.

GELO #1 - Speech Communication Credits: 3

GELO #2 - Written Communication Credits: 3

GELO #5 - Analytical, Quantitative, and Scientific Reasoning Credits: 3      

Select classes from the GELOs listed below for a minimum of 6 credit hours.  
     No classes from the same GELO.

GELO #3 - Critical Thinking and Problem Solving

GELO #4 - Global Awareness and Citizenship

GELO #6 - Career and Life Skills

Total: 15 hours


Total: 51 hours


Total: 66 hours


**A maximum of 2.0 credit hours of Special Welding Applications can be used toward any award.

Requires 51 credit hours of welding courses and five General Education courses (15 credit hours), for a total of 66 hours. See program advisor.
